Ipswich Town produced a dominant 6-0 victory over Sheffield United at Portman Road, moving to 11th in the Championship. Jaden Philogene scored a hat-trick, George Hirst added a goal and an assist, and Jack Clarke completed the scoring. Ipswich recorded 11 shots on target compared to Sheffield United's 10 total attempts and posted 2.6 expected goals to 0.42. Philogene scored in the 20th minute, Hirst assisted Philogene's second early in the second half and later scored himself before Philogene completed his treble and Clarke scored in the 78th minute. Sheffield United have lost their first five matches.
